Hello,

Regarding the STM32N657, I'm not using the internal SMPS.  My question is:  Do we need to put capacitors on the 6 VDDSMPS pins or can they be left as no connect?   

Same question on the VLXSMPS pins... do we need the capacitors on these pins, or can they be left as no connect?

Also, on the STM32N657-DK board, there is a snubber circuit on the VLXSMPS pins, why?

mattcrc_0-1761592495500.png

Finally, when I say "No connect", I assume these pins are connected internally, so it does not require an external link on the PCB when not used.  Is this correct?  (this will probably make the routing of the PCB easier)

We are dealing with a very Very VERY small PCB, and saving the space used by 12 x 0402 makes a difference.

VDDSMPS must be grounded when SMPS is not used. Capacitors are not needed.

*Getting started with hardware development for STM32N6 MCUs - Application note
